Ticket: staging schema registry misconfigured. EventSpine registry on the staging cluster was started with validation disabled and an empty auth section, so producers registered schemas anonymously for ~6 hours. No production impact; staging topics quarantined. Remediation: rotate the registry credential, re-enable strict mode, redeploy. The corrected .env must include the registry admin credential as its final line, shown below.

sealed setting: RELAY_SECRET5=82864

## 2.4.0 — Watchdog defaults changed

KioskPane's watchdog now restarts the shell after two missed heartbeats instead of five, and the heartbeat interval drops from 30s to 10s. Rationale: field units in the Brellton pilot hung for minutes before recovery. Review the diff against prior assumptions. The new effective defaults are as follows.

settings of bawif-fawif:
ralix:
  log_level: warn
  metrics_host: metrics.ralix.tolvaqsys.internal
  pool_size: 32

## Further Reading

Digest scheduling in Mailvane runs off the `batch-cadence` config, not cron. Release cuts must not ship mid-window or recipients get split digests. Check the freeze calendar before tagging. Quiet hours, retry backoff, and per-tenant overrides are documented separately; skim them before each release. Full scheduling internals, including the window resolver logic, live on the internal page below.

dashboard of yahaf-kajep = https://jira.zemvarsys.internal/display/projects/browse/browse/a08b

Internal Memo — Regional Sales Review

To the board of Tarvelline Instruments. The eastern region exceeded targets by 7%, driven by the Mirosk series. The coastal region fell short by 4%, attributed to delayed stock. Corrective steps include revised allocation and an additional field representative. Full figures are in the appendix. Please note the confidential remark on business plans set out directly below.

board note of bajop-yaweg: The western region missed its Pelys quota by 58.0 percent last quarter. Pelysek Foods plans to raise the Belius list price by 44.0 percent in July. The steering committee signed off on a budget of $133.8 million for Project Pelax. The renewal with Zoraelix Systems closes at $61.9 million a year, 12.7 percent above the last contract.